CODE AMENDMENT CO -12-07: CONSIDERATION OF A MORATORIUM EXTENSION REGARDING HOOKAH PARLORS — Development Service Department/Planning Division RECOMMENDATION: City Council adopt Urgency Ordinance No. 14-xx, to be read by title only and waive further reading, regarding an extension of the hookah parlor moratorium considered under Code Amendment CO -12-07 for a period not to exceed 12 months. 2. CODE AMENDMENT CO -14-03: AN ORDINANCE O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F COSTA MESA, CALIFORNIA, AMENDING SECTION 13-6 (DEFINITIONS) OF ARTICLE 2 (DEFINITIONS) OF CHAPTER I (GENERAL), ADDING CHAPTER XV (GROUP HOMES), AND REPEALING AND REPLACING ARTICLE 15 (REASONABLE ACCOMMODATIONS) OF CHAPTER IX (SPECIAL LAND USE REGULATIONS), OF TITLE 13 (ZONING CODE) AND AMENDING THE CITY OF COSTA MESA LAND USE MATRIX -TABLE NO. 13-30 OF CHAPTER IV. (CITYWIDE LAND USE MATRIX) OF THE COSTA MESA MUNICIPAL CODE RELATING TO GROUP HOMES — Development Services Department/Community Improvement Division RECOMMENDATION: The Planning Commission recommends that the City Council take the following actions with regard to the proposed ordinance to amend Title 13, Chapter(s) I, IV and IX, and to add Chapter XV (Group Homes) to the Costa Mesa Municipal Code with regard to group homes ("Group Home Ordinance"): City Council find that the proposed ordinance is exempt from California Environmental Quality Act (CEQA) pursuant to Section 15061(b)(3) (General Rule) of CEQA because there is no possibility that the proposed amendment to the Zoning Code will have a significant effect on the environment; and 2. City Council approve and give first reading to Ordinance No. 14-xx, to be read by title only and waive further reading, relating to Group Homes. REVIEW OF PLANNING APPLICATION PA -88-134 A2: SECOND AMENDMENT FOR THE ORANGE COAST BUICK/GMC/CADILLAC DEALERSHIP LOCATED AT 2600 HARBOR BOULEVARD — Development Services Department/Planning Division RECOMMENDATION: The Planning Commission recommends that the City Council take the following action: 1. Find that the project is categorically exempt from CEQA per the Class 32 Categorical Exemption for infill development; and 2. Approve second amendment to Planning Application PA -88-134 for the Orange Coast Buick/GMC/Cadillac dealership to construct a 34,000 square foot second floor parking deck over a portion of the previously permitted 52,779 square foot automotive dealership building, as well as a portion of the proposed parking lot, for storage of vehicle inventory; and 3. Approve Administrative Adjustment to deviate from rear yard setback requirements for the proposed second floor parking deck (50 -foot rear yard setback required; 32 -foot setback proposed). A previous variance for a 0 foot rear setback was approved under PA -88-134. A 32 -foot rear yard setback for the dealership building was approved under PA -88-134 Al; and 4. Approve a Planned Sign Program for the following signage: Remove the existing 40 - foot high freestanding sign and replace with two new freestanding signs, both 23 feet in height. The two proposed freestanding signs are separated by approximately 190 feet. The overall square footage of the proposed freestanding and wall signs complies with the Costa Mesa Municipal Code (CCMC). The overall square footage of freestanding and wall signs is 442 sq. ft. OLD BUSINESS - NONE NEW BUSINESS 1. URBAN MASTER PLAN SCREENING REQUEST (UMP -14-04) FOR A 32 -UNIT LIVE/WORK DEVELOPMENT LOCATED AT 1672 PLACENTIA AVENUE — Development Services Department/Planning Division RECOMMENDATION: City Council provide feedback on a proposed Urban Master Plan for a live/work project within the Mesa West Bluffs Urban Plan. The project consists of 32 detached three-story units with roof decks.
